III. VALIDITY PERIOD, LOCK-UP PERIOD AND UNLOCKING ARRANGEMENTS OF THE INCENTIVE SCHEME

  • (I) The Validity Period of the Incentive Scheme commences from the date of completion of registration of the Grant of Restricted Shares and ends on the date when all the Restricted Shares granted to the Participants are unlocked or repurchased for cancellation, and shall not exceed 60 months in any event.

  • (II) The Lock-up Period of the Incentive Scheme shall be 24 months, 36 months and 48 months from the date of completion of registration of the Grant of Restricted Shares respectively. The Restricted Shares granted to the Participants under the Incentive Scheme shall be subject to lock-up restrictions and shall not be transferred, pledged for any guarantee or used for repayment of debt during the Lock-up Period.

  • (III) The Unlocking Periods and arrangements for each of the Unlocking Periods of the Restricted Shares granted under Incentive Scheme are set out in the table below:

If the Company’s targets for performance assessment for a particular Unlocking Period of the Restricted Shares are not met, all the Restricted Shares of the Participants for that period shall not be unlocked and shall be repurchased by the Company for cancellation. The repurchase price shall not be higher than the lower of the Grant Price and the market price of the shares (being the average trading price of the Company’s underlying shares on the trading day immediately preceding the date on which the Board considers the repurchase).

IV. CAPITAL VERIFICATION FOR SUBSCRIPTION AMOUNTS OF THE RESTRICTED SHARES

Xin Lianyi Certified Public Accountants LLP ((新聯誼會計師事務所) (特殊普通合夥)) issued the Capital Verification Report (Xin Lianyi Yan Zi (2022) No. 0001): As at 12 February 2022, the Company received subscription amounts of RMB723,592,800 paid by 1,245 Participants for the subscription of 61,740,000 Restricted Shares, with RMB61,740,000 of which being included in share capital and RMB661,852,800 of which being included in capital reserve.

V. REGISTRATION OF RESTRICTED SHARES

The registration procedures for the Grant of Restricted Shares under the Incentive Scheme were completed on 24 February 2022, and the CSDC Shanghai Branch issued a Certificate of Registration of Changes in Securities therefor.

VI. EFFECTS ON THE CONTROLLING SHAREHOLDER OF THE COMPANY BEFORE AND AFTER THE GRANT

Upon completion of registration of the Grant under the Incentive Scheme (the date of registration is 24 February 2022), the total number of shares of the Company increased from 4,874,184,060 to 4,935,924,060, resulting in the change in the percentage of shareholding of the controlling shareholder of the Company. Before the Grant, Shandong Energy Group Company Limited, the controlling shareholder of the Company, directly and indirectly held 2,718,036,288 shares of the Company, representing 55.76% of the total share capital of the Company before registration of the Grant. Upon completion of registration of the Grant, its shares held represent 55.07% of the total share capital of the Company and it remains as the controlling shareholder of the Company.

IX. EFFECTS OF THE NEW SHARES ISSUED UNDER THE GRANT ON THE FINANCIAL REPORT

The Company determined the fair value of the Restricted Shares on the Grant Date and subsequently recognized the share-based payment expenses under the Incentive Scheme according to the relevant requirements of the accounting standards. Such expenses will be recognized in installments over the course of the implementation of the Incentive Scheme in proportion to the number of Restricted Shares to be unlocked. The total incentive costs arisen from the Incentive Scheme are estimated to be RMB790,272,000 and the amortization of the costs of the Restricted Shares during the period from 2022 to 2026 is set out in the table below:
